In the high-stakes world of elite football, where patience often yields to immediate gratification, FC Barcelona has once again demonstrated its long-standing commitment to nurturing homegrown talent. The club officially announced the contract extension of promising midfielder Marc Bernal until 2029, a move that solidifies their belief in the 18-year-old`s potential, even as he navigates the delicate path back from a significant injury.

A Setback and a Season of Resilience
However, the journey to the top is rarely without its trials. For Bernal, that trial arrived on August 27, 2024, when a severe knee injury sidelined him for an entire year. His recent return to competitive action, albeit in limited minutes – a modest nine against Valencia and a symbolic one against Oviedo – might seem insignificant to the casual observer. Yet, for Bernal and the club, these brief appearances are monumental milestones, signaling the successful completion of a painstaking recovery. Hansi Flick`s Measured Approach
The strategic blueprint for Bernal`s reintegration into the senior setup has been meticulously drawn by new head coach, Hansi Flick. The plan is, as one might expect from a top-tier coaching staff, to introduce him «col contagocce» – or, as the English idiom goes, drop by drop. This measured approach is not a lack of faith, but rather a pragmatic recognition of the demands of professional football, particularly after a long layoff. Rushing a player back from a serious knee injury can be detrimental, risking further damage and derailing a promising career. Flick`s methodology emphasizes caution, ensuring Bernal`s physical readiness aligns with his technical re-acclimatization, allowing him to regain confidence and rhythm without undue pressure.

A Future Forged in Trust
The official signing ceremony, attended by prominent figures such as President Joan Laporta, First Vice President Rafael Yuste, and Football Director Deco, underscores the institutional weight behind this renewal.
